About This Audiobook

In 'Random Survival: The Road: Weatherman', Ray Wenck serves up a unique twist on the post-apocalyptic genre. Instead of zombies or alien invasions, we're treated to a pandemic that's as unpredictable as the weather. Narrator Jack de Golia brings a folksy charm that's both comforting and jarring, given the grim subject matter. What sets this audiobook apart is its blend of survivalist grit and whimsical touches, like a protagonist who's a former weatherman with a penchant for puns. It's like 'The Walking Dead' meets 'Groundhog Day', with a dash of 'The Martian' thrown in.

Editor's Review ★★★★☆

AudioBook Atlas

Jack de Golia's narration is a real treat. He imbues Darwin 'Weatherman' Merriweather with a folksy charm that's both endearing and believable. His pacing is spot on, capturing the urgency of survival situations and the quiet moments of reflection that make this story so compelling. The story itself is a refreshing take on the post-apocalyptic genre. Wenck's use of weather as a plot device is genius, adding an element of unpredictability that keeps you on the edge of your seat. My only critique is that some of the secondary characters could have been more fully developed. But overall, this is a standout listen that will appeal to fans of survival stories and unique world-building.
